how much low fat milk (1% fat) and how much whole milk (4 % fat) should be mixed to make a 5gal of reduced fat milk (2% fat)?

x+y=5

1x+4y=5•2

Not sure if my equations are set up the correct way. I am confused on what to do since they are in percent. Please help thank you!
<pre>Answer to  your QUESTION: "Yes, your equations are correct!" What you did was multiply the percents by 100, thus making 1%, 1, 4%, 4, and 2%, 2.
Now just continue to solve for each type of milk. 
You can either use ELIMINATION or SUBSTITUTION. You choose!!
